Parking Lot Expansion in Savannah, GA
Parking lot expansion services involve increasing the size and capacity of existing parking areas to accommodate more vehicles. This type of project typically covers enlarging current lots, creating additional parking spaces, or redesigning layouts to improve traffic flow and accessibility. Property owners considering parking lot expansion should evaluate factors such as available space, drainage considerations, and the intended use of the expanded area to ensure the project aligns with their needs and property layout.
Before requesting parking lot expansion,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the work involved, including any necessary site assessments, permits, and potential impact on existing structures or landscaping. Clarifying the desired number of new parking spaces, access points, and overall design goals can help streamline the planning process. It’s also helpful to consider long-term usage and maintenance needs to ensure the expanded lot remains functional and efficient over time.

Parking Lot Expansion Questions
What types of parking lot expansion projects are common? Common projects include adding new parking spaces, widening existing lots, and creating designated areas for specific vehicle types.
How does parking lot expansion benefit property owners? Expansion can increase capacity, improve traffic flow, and enhance the overall appearance of the property.
What materials are typically used for parking lot expansion? Asphalt and concrete are the most common materials used for durable and long-lasting parking lot surfaces.
Is planning needed before starting a parking lot expansion? Yes, proper planning ensures the expansion fits the property layout and meets any local regulations or codes.
